WebGastrointestinal (GI) foreign bodies occur when pets consume items that are non-digestible and will not readily pass through their stomach or intestines. These items may be toys (Figure 2), leashes, clothing, sticks, or any other item that fails to pass, including human food products such as bones or trash. When these items become lodged in the ... WebObstruction occurring near the beginning of the intestines (closest to the stomach) tends to cause more severe and more frequent vomiting. Intussusception (telescoping of the intestines) may cause vomiting, abdominal pain, and scant bloody diarrhea.
